    EDM Calibration Baseline Fitting

    EDM Calibration Baseline Fitting

    EDMFit is an adjustment tool to estimate EDM calibration parameters.

    An EDM calibration baseline is used to derive specific instrument errors of the electronic distance measurement (EDM) unit of a total station. EDMFit is a simple adjustment tool to estimate the EDM calibration parameters (addition constant and/or scale parameter). The adjustment process is according to ISO 17123-4. The parameters are checked for significance, to avoid an overestimation. Based on two classical hypothesis testing, EDMFit provides a reliable outlier detection. For...

    The Panini Language

    The Panini Language

    Better Modularity, Better Concurrency

    This project makes the compiler and tools for the Panini language available. A central goal of the Panini language is to make concurrent programming easier and less error-prone. The main new feature in Panini is called a capsule. A capsule is like an actor but better because it largely retains the traditional approach for reasoning about programs as a sequence of operations, abstracts away all details of thread creation and locking, and supports fully-automatic compile-time analysis of...

    Log Templater

    Templater is a fast log processor for security engineers

    Log Templater has moved to GitHub (https://github.com/rondilley/tmpltr) Templater is a small and fast log processor that provides simple artificial ignorance capabilities. You use the tool to process past log data and store templates that represent normal log line structures. You then run the tool against current or target logs and all normal patterns are automatically ignored. The parser is fast and capable of processing millions of lines per minute. Log Templater runs pretty fast. The...

    cloc (Count Lines Of Code) counts, and computes differences of, comment lines, blank lines, and physical lines of source code in many programming languages. cloc is now being developed at https://github.com/AlDanial/cloc
